Output 108fb0e0e4e84f42bf91758b46e93bcda946240b09373d927fe5cc26467b53fc:0

value
120000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f0866d3af27dc2a39fd5385454c25c2ad62cae0 OP_EQUAL
address
3K773wZKbFH4Md8dPpBxYJCVsruuHsMzsM
transaction
108fb0e0e4e84f42bf91758b46e93bcda946240b09373d927fe5cc26467b53fc
confirmations
132225
spent
true